Your issue will be at least one of:
1. You downloaded an ancient copy of the keydb from the wrong site instead of the one I linked in my instructions
2. You didn’t extract the keydb.cfg file from the downloaded zip file
3. You put the extracted keydb.cfg file in the wrong folder
4. (Linux/macOS only) You didn’t rename the keydb.cfg file to the case-sensitive KEYDB.cfg file required by certain filesystem configurations
